Alles lesenOlivia learns that after a whirlwind romance her best friend since childhood is getting married and moving from New York to a ranch in Wyoming. She then decides to do a bachelorette retreat for her to a Dude Ranch in the country in an attempt to discourage her from leaving New York. Things don't go quite as planned and she finds herself falling for the owners son.

What I do mind is the bitchy fake female lead character. She just seemed so superficial and know-it-all, it's really annoying. Christopher Russell is cut out for the cowboy role and really delivers but Stephanie Bennet is a trainwreck in this one. In this movie, she just comes across as the bitchy popular cheerleader who gets a kick out of embarrassing the nerd in front of the whole school. Either she was the wrong actress for the role or the scriptwriters just wrote a bad character.
The rest of the cast is great and have the right charm for the role but with such an underwhelming lead, the supporting cast, fun storyline, and beautiful scenery just can't salvage the movie. I'm quite alright with the shallow nature of these Hallmark-type tv romance movies, I find it easy to watch but this one is a major let down.

I'm not sure this is actually Yellowstone. I think they said her friend was moving to Wyoming, so that would be the Yellowstone factor, however, the romance that supposedly happens in Yellowstone doesn't. In fact, it has nothing to do with Yellowstone. So why the false advertising? I think they were actually in Colorado, because the father says something about her not being from Denver, so that's a clue, but maybe I missed something. Now that's out of the way, here's my thoughts about the film. The lead female is despicable at first, indeed very easy to dislike, but as you will see, this changes ever so slowly over time. She does become somewhat endearing eventually. But she's not a daisy, she still retains some fire. She's an assertive and opinionated city girl, after all. But her true colors flash now and then and she's predominantly likable. Of course the lead male is to die for. If I had to choose the hottest, rugged men of Hallmark, he would be in the group along with Donovan, MacFarlane, Walker, Hynes, Polaha, Rosner and Paevey. I'm a dude and even I can tell who the ladies dig. The story is standard and there is nothing new, so we have to rely on whatever originality the actors give us. The city slicker mentality is awkward in a backwoods cowboy town, so that was nice and tense. Otherwise, it's just a simple love story between a blond bombshell and her very own cowboy. There is some competition with the female ranch hand, which added some drama, but not enough.
